H3944

Motor Vehicles

Chamber Passed·4/23/25

Allows electric battery-powered vehicles to exceed weight limits by up to 2,000 pounds each.

The bill amends South Carolina law to allow electric battery-powered vehicles to exceed gross, single axle, tandem axle, or bridge formula weight limits by up to 2,000 pounds each, up to a maximum gross vehicle weight of eighty-two thousand pounds. This allowance applies both within the state and on interstates, where federal law permits. The change takes effect upon approval by the Governor.
